e are happy to offer classes on any topic you choose. In order to arrange a special class, we require registrations from at least six participants. A three-hour class costs $56 per person, including the food. Below is a list of classes to choose from, or you may contact us with your own idea. If you've always wanted to learn how to do a cooking technique or become familiar with new ingredients, get a few friends together for a fun and delicious experience!

  • Green Salads: After the Lettuce (sample menu: salads with crispy chicken fingers, baked goat cheese, roasted pears, garlic croutons, herb vinaigrette, classic Caesar dressing, creamy dill dressing, blue cheese dressing)
  • Beans and Greens (sample menu: whole wheat pasta with greens, beans, pancetta, and garlic bread crumbs; Indian-spiced lentils with kale; quick-cooked collard greens with bacon and black-eyed peas; bruschette with chickpea puree and arugula; black beans and rice with butternut squash)
  • The Secret's in the Sauce (sample menu: pan-seared steak with red wine-thyme sauce, sautéed chicken with lemon-caper pan sauce, mashed potatoes with gravy, spaghetti with Bolognese, asparagus with hollandaise, vanilla ice cream with raspberry coulis)
  • Picnic Food (sample menu: fried chicken, classic potato salad, creamy egg salad with variations, caprese salad with handmade mozzarella, three-bean salad, brownies, summer fruit salad)
  • You Say Potato (sample menu: oven-baked French fries, smashed potatoes, spicy Greek-style garlic-lemon potatoes, creamy potato soup with chives, mashed potatoes with root vegetables, Indian-style potato curry)
  • Classes for teens and adults to cook together
  • Food Science for Teens
